on the first try on SuSe I couldn't make it work: I got an error

Can't connect to local MySQL server through socket '/tmp/mysql.sock' (2)

this error is produced because the mysql client shipped with the extension is trying to establish a connection to the local MySQL server through a socket located in /tmp/mysql.sock, while in SuSe the default installation for the system tables et al. is in /var/lib/mysql/, so there is also located the socket mysql.sock

Although this is not a very big issue (even the dumbest user can Google that error message and find a suitable workaround), could this be fixed by adding some driver property setting or whatever?
